Same complaints I guess.

I thought it was a cool concept, people don't do the space thing too much on NG and the character designs were definitely the strong point. The pacing and music choice were also good.
But I have the same complaint with your stuff every time, the movements. Your animation comes off sometimes like you never touch the Onionskin and just make each frame in order from start to finish without looking back to check if the movement looks convincing, and your stuff ends up looking like 2001 flash when people were just kind of using it and didn't know its potential. I think you're full of great 80s-esque cartoon ideas, but the animation itself just robs it of all the fun for me.
